Ticket: LUMEN-442 — expired creds blocking hermetic migration

While moving the Orrisfield build onto the new hermetic toolchain (Kilnbox), the cached fetcher credential expired and nothing could pull vendored deps. For future maintainers: Kilnbox sandboxes block ambient creds, so the fetcher key must live in the sealed config. I rotated it today; the replacement key goes here.

gateway credential: kto7_GoY89Me

Ticket: Staging env misconfigured for Siftgate bloom filter

The bloom layer in front of the Pellet KV store is rejecting all lookups in staging because the env file was copied from the dev template without credentials. False-positive tuning values are fine; only the auth line is missing. To unblock the weekly demo, the Pellet admission secret must be set on the following line.

env line for yaguf-fajop: LEDGER_TOKEN13=fb08984397349

MEMO — Kettling Depot Receiving

Uniform sets for the new Kettling depot arrive Wednesday via Ashgrove courier: 40 boxes, sorted by size, manifest attached to box one. Check the count at the dock before signing; shortages go straight to stores, not the courier. The hand-over instruction the courier will follow is set out below.

drop instructions, tafof-baguf: the holmir gilox courier leaves the sormir ulaok holdor ledger at gate 5596 under passcode 257343

# Break-Glass: Catalog Cache Invalidation

Scope: the Pinrow product catalog at Veldstone Retail. If stale prices persist after a purge and the Hollowmere invalidation queue is wedged, use break-glass to flush the edge tier directly. Contractors: get verbal sign-off from the catalog lead first. Steps: open the Hollowmere admin shell, select emergency-flush, confirm the tenant, and run it once — repeated flushes thrash the origin. Access is logged and expires after 20 minutes. Unseal the admin shell with the passphrase below.

recovery phrase for kahop-tajog: istix-casvan

Night shift: evacuation-chair store on Stairwell C, Level 3, was restocked today. Two Havermont chairs serviced, one sent to Drayle Safety for repair. Check the seal on the store door at 02:00 rounds. If the seal is broken, log it and re-secure. Door access for the store uses the pass below.

staff pass of fajop-kajop = bdg-H-83